OUR CORE VALUES ARE BASED UPON BIBLICAL TEACHING
We strive to teach God's Word with integrity and authority so that seekers find Christ and believers mature in Him (2 Tim. 3:16).
INTERCESSORY PRAYER
We rely on private and corporate prayer in the conception, planning, and execution of all the ministries and activities of this church (Matt. 7:7-11).
REACHING LOST PEOPLE
We value unchurched, lost people and will use every available Christ-honoring means to pursue, win, and disciple them (Luke 19:10)
AUTHENTIC WORSHIP
We desire to acknowledge God's supreme value and worth in our personal lives and in the corporate, contemporary worship of our church (Rom. 12:1-2).
MOBILIZED CONGREGATION
We seek to equip all our uniquely designed and gifted people to effectively accomplish the work of our ministry (Eph. 4:11-13).*
FAMILY
We support the spiritual nurture of the family as one of God's dynamic means to perpetuate the Christian faith (2 Tim. 1:5).
SENSE OF COMMUNITY
We ask all our people to commit to and fully participate in biblically functioning, and small groups where they may reach the lost, exercise their gifts, be shepherded, and thus grow in Christlikeness (Acts 2:44-46).
MINISTRY EXCELLENCE
Since God gave His best (the Savior), we seek to honor Him by maintaining high standard of excellence in all our ministries and activities (Col. 3:23-24).*
